SICILY, Syracuse. Second Democracy. 466-405 BC. Æ Hexas (14mm, 2.67 g, 8h). Obverse die signed by the artist E(uainetos)(?). Struck circa 410-405 BC. Head of Arethousa left, hair in sphendone; small E behind neck / Octopus. E. Favorito, “The Signed Bronzes of Syracuse” in The Celator 10, 7 (July 1996), fig. 2; Holloway, Further, Series 2; CNS 14; HGC 2, 1430 corr. (E not noted, no pellets on rev. of CNS 14). Dark green patina with spots of red. Near EF. |
